Wind energy (30%) in the Spanish power mix—technically feasible and economically reasonable
Authors:Ghassan Zubi  José L Bernal-AgustínAna B Fandos Marín
Affiliation:Department of Electrical Engineering, University of Zaragoza, Calle María de Luna 3, 50018-Zaragoza, Spain
Abstract:The installed wind power capacity in Spain has grown strongly in recent years. In 2007, wind parks supplied already 10% of the 260 TWh generated electricity. Along that year the installed wind capacity grew by 33.2%, from 11.63 GW in January to 15.5 GW in December. Wind is nowadays the primer renewable power source in Spain, while the public perception of renewables in general is very positive. The issue of the integration of wind power as a fluctuating source into the power grid is gaining priority.
